Mel Gilden

    Mel Gilden is a prolific author whose works span genres and age groups, earning acclaim in publications like School Library Journal and Booklist. His multi-part children's stories were a frequent feature in the Los Angeles Times, while his novels and short stories for adults have garnered positive reviews in the Washington Post and beyond. Gilden's versatility is evident in his adaptations of popular media, including feature films and television shows, as well as original stories set in the Star Trek universe. His career also encompasses screenwriting for television and consulting on theme park attractions, showcasing a broad creative and narrative talent.
